How to Write a Strong Description for Your Twitter Space?

Launching a Twitter Space is an exciting way to connect, share ideas, and build community around your interests. However, one of the most crucial elements that can determine the success of your Space is its description. A well-crafted description not only attracts potential listeners but also sets clear expectations, encouraging engagement and participation. In this article, we'll explore effective strategies to write a compelling and strong description for your Twitter Space that captures attention and drives interest.

How to Write a Strong Description for Your Twitter Space?


1. Understand Your Audience and Purpose

Before writing your Space description, it’s essential to identify who your target audience is and what you aim to achieve. Are you hosting a professional panel, a casual chat, or an educational session? Clarifying your purpose helps tailor your language and content to resonate with listeners.

  • Define your target audience: Are they industry professionals, hobbyists, students, or a general audience?
  • Clarify your goals: Is it to inform, entertain, network, or promote?
  • Identify the core topics: What specific subjects will you cover?

For example, if you're hosting a Space about digital marketing trends for small business owners, your description should directly speak to that group’s interests and needs.


2. Craft a Clear and Concise Opening Statement

Your opening lines should immediately communicate the essence of your Space. Think of this as your hook—what will make someone want to click and listen?

  • Summarize the main theme: Use a compelling sentence that captures the core topic.
  • Highlight the value: Clearly state what listeners will gain.
  • Be specific: Avoid vague terms. Instead of “Join us for a discussion,” say “Join us to learn the latest social media strategies for 2024.”

Example: “Join industry experts as they explore innovative marketing tactics that can help your small business thrive in 2024.”


3. Use Keywords Strategically

SEO isn't just for websites—your Twitter Space description can benefit from relevant keywords to improve discoverability.

  • Identify relevant keywords: Think about terms your target audience might search for, such as “digital marketing,” “startup tips,” or “mental health awareness.”
  • Incorporate naturally: Use keywords seamlessly within your description without keyword stuffing.
  • Include hashtags: Consider adding hashtags related to your topic to increase visibility.

For example, including phrases like “Join our #MentalHealthSpace to discuss coping strategies” can attract viewers searching for that hashtag.


4. Highlight Speakers and Guests

If your Space features notable speakers, industry experts, or influencers, mention them in the description. This adds credibility and piques curiosity.

  • Introduce key participants: Briefly mention their expertise or relevance.
  • Share credentials or achievements: For example, “with Jane Doe, TED speaker and founder of XYZ”.
  • Use their influence to attract listeners: People may tune in to hear from familiar or authoritative voices.

Example: “Join us for a conversation with John Smith, a renowned cybersecurity expert, as we discuss the latest threats and protection strategies.”


5. Include a Call-to-Action (CTA)

A compelling CTA encourages listeners to join, participate, or share the Space.

  • Invite participation: “Tune in to ask questions live.”
  • Encourage sharing: “Share this Space with your network.”
  • Specify timings: “Join us at 3 PM EST on March 15th.”

Example: “Don’t miss out! Join us live at 5 PM PST to explore the future of remote work and share your thoughts.”


6. Maintain a Friendly and Engaging Tone

The tone of your description influences listener perception. Aim for a friendly, approachable voice that reflects the vibe of your Space.

  • Be inviting: Use welcoming language such as “Join us,” “Explore,” and “Discover.”
  • Avoid jargon: Keep language simple and accessible.
  • Show enthusiasm: Express excitement about the topic to generate interest.

For example: “We’re excited to bring you an engaging discussion on latest tech innovations—come be part of the conversation!”


7. Keep It Well-Structured and Readable

Your description should be easy to scan quickly. Use short paragraphs, bullet points, and clear headings to organize information effectively.

  • Use headings and subheadings: Break down sections for clarity.
  • Include line breaks: Separate ideas for better readability.
  • Be concise: Avoid lengthy blocks of text—get to the point efficiently.

This approach ensures potential listeners can quickly grasp what your Space is about and why they should join.


8. Proofread and Test Your Description

Before publishing, double-check for typos, grammatical errors, and clarity. A polished description reflects professionalism and builds trust.

  • Read aloud: To catch awkward phrasing.
  • Ask for feedback: Get a second opinion from a colleague or friend.
  • Ensure accuracy: Confirm all details like date, time, and guest names.

Test the visibility of your keywords and ensure the description aligns with your intended message.
